Huntsman Spider

Family Sparassidae

Description:

Sparassidae is a family of spiders known as huntsman spiders because of their speed and mode of hunting. They use venom to immobilise prey and to assist in digestion. As adults, huntsman spiders do not build webs, but hunt and forage for food. They are able to travel extremely fast, often using a springing jump while running.
